About This Camera

This live camera streams from Hanalei Bay Resort on the north shore of Kauai, overlooking one of the most breathtaking bays in all of Hawaii. Hanalei Bay is a two-mile crescent of golden sand framed by emerald mountains and dramatic sea cliffs — a landscape that has appeared in countless films and postcards. The camera captures the wide sweep of the bay, the turquoise water, and the lush ridgeline of the Namolokama mountain range that rises sharply behind the town. Hanalei Bay is a year-round destination with dramatically different seasonal personalities. During the winter months from October through April, the north shore receives powerful swells from the North Pacific that produce world-class surf along the outer reef. On big days, waves can reach 15 to 20 feet, drawing experienced surfers from around the world. Summer brings calm, flat water ideal for swimming, stand-up paddleboarding, kayaking, and snorkeling along the reef edges. Best viewing times are early morning (6-9 AM HST) when the bay is glassy and the first light illuminates the mountains. Sunset sessions are equally spectacular as the sun dips toward the horizon and paints the sky behind the Makana ridgeline — the iconic peak featured in the movie South Pacific. Whale watching is excellent from December through April when humpback whales pass through the channel offshore. The town of Hanalei is a small, charming community with local restaurants, surf shops, taro fields, and the historic Waioli Huiia Church. Nearby attractions include Tunnels Beach, the Kalalau Trail along the Na Pali Coast, Lumahai Beach, and the Hanalei Pier — one of the most photographed landmarks on Kauai.
